pet shop dubai
pet shop dubaipet store dubaipet supplies dubaiThe location is good since its in central city , and there are numerous community parking places nearby. Chances are you'll get anything your dog could maybe have to have, from food and accessories to some grooming support, all in a single easy location. Lots of animals, such as birds, fish, and reptil